Water connection Water supply NOTICE The washing machine must only be operated with hot (max. 140 °F / 60 °C) and cold tap water. Do not connect the appliance to the mixer tap of an unpressurized hotĆwater boiler. If in doubt, have the water connection installed by an authorized technician. The water supply hoses must not be: - Kinked, bent or flattened in such a way as to potentially diminish water flow. - Modified or cut (integrity can no longer be guaranteed). Periodic inspection and replacement of damaged or kinked hoses is recommended. Replacement of the water supply hoses after five years of use may help reduce the risk of hose failure. Observe the water pressure in the supply network: - The water pressure should be between 20 and 120 p.s.i. (1.38 and 8.27 bar) when the faucet is turned on and at least 2.2 U. S. gallons (8 liters) of water should be discharged per minute. - A pressure regulator valve must be installed if the maximum water pressure is exceeded. NOTICE To prevent water damage, the hot and cold water valves should be accessible when the washing machine is in place and should always be turned off when the washing machine is not in use. NOTICE If installing the washing machine in a new building or a building in which the plumbing system was recently installed or upgraded, flush the lines before installing the washing machine to remove any sand, dirt or residue. Supply Line Connection C Cold water connection H Hot water connection (max. 140 °F / 60 °C) q Do not remove the strainers from the water supply hoses. q Check to be sure the rubber washer/strainer is in the Aquastopt hose prior to attaching the hose to the faucet. It is not necessary to remove the washer to clean the strainer. To clean, rinse under running water. If necessary, lightly wipe the wire mesh strainer to help dislodge any accumulated debris. q Also check to be sure the rubber washer is present in the end of the Aquastopthose that attaches to the appliance. q Plastic threads must only be tightened by hand. Connect the water supply hoses to the back of the washer. q Tighten only metal-to-metal couplings (eg: connecting the Aquastopt hose to the faucet) an additional two-thirds turn using pliers. Do not use pliers to tighten plastic thread fittings onto plastic or metal threads. min.0,4'' (10 mm) q After connecting, turn on the water completely and check that connection points are watertight. Hose Extension The Aquastopt hose may not fit in the space available at the wall faucet. A short extension hose (part no. 645787 ) is available without charge through customer service (see page 31). Other hoses Available from appliance dealers: - Extended supply hose (approx. 96.1 in. /2.44 m). d CAUTION The connection points are under full water pressure. Check seal with faucet fully open. 12
